编程控制是什么专业的

fiy 其他 5

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程控制是计算机科学与技术领域中的一个专业方向。它主要涉及编程语言、操作系统、计算机网络、数据库等相关技术的学习和应用。

    首先,编程控制专业对编程语言有深入的学习和理解。学生需要学习和掌握不同编程语言的语法、数据结构和算法,以及面向对象编程、函数式编程等编程范式。除了基本的编程语言如C、C++、Java之外,还需要了解一些新兴的编程语言如Python、JavaScript,以应对不同的编程需求。

    其次,编程控制专业还涉及操作系统的学习。学生需要了解操作系统的原理、功能和结构,学会使用操作系统进行进程调度、资源管理和文件系统操作。掌握操作系统的知识可以使学生更好地编写高效的程序,并且可以提供良好的用户体验。

    此外,编程控制专业还包括计算机网络的学习。学生需要了解网络协议、网络通信原理、网络安全等知识,学会编写网络应用程序和进行网络管理。掌握网络编程技术可以使学生开发出具有良好的网络性能和安全性的应用程序。

    最后,数据库也是编程控制专业不可忽视的一部分。学生需要学习数据库的设计、管理和优化等知识,能够熟练地使用SQL语言进行数据库操作,同时也需要了解大数据和数据分析等相关概念和技术。

    总之,编程控制是一个综合性强的专业,它需要学生具备扎实的编程基础、深入的专业知识和不断学习的能力。毕业后,学生可以在软件开发、系统管理、网络安全等领域找到就业机会,并且可以不断深入和拓展自己的技术能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程控制是计算机科学与技术领域的一个专业方向。它主要关注计算机软件开发和编程技术的应用与研究,以实现对计算机硬件和软件系统的有效控制。下面是关于编程控制专业的五个要点。

    1. 理论基础:编程控制专业注重培养学生的计算机科学和软件工程方面的理论基础。这包括计算机系统结构、操作系统、数据结构与算法、数据库设计和管理、编程语言原理等方面的知识。学生需要掌握计算机的工作原理、数据处理与存储、软件开发流程等关键概念。

    2. 软件开发技术:编程控制专业还注重培养学生的软件开发技术。学生需要学习多种编程语言,如C++、Java、Python等,以及相关的开发框架和工具。他们还需要学会使用集成开发环境(IDE)来编写、调试和测试程序代码。此外,学生还会学习软件开发的最佳实践,如版本控制、软件测试和质量保证等。

    3. 应用领域:编程控制专业的学生通常会涉及到各种应用领域,如互联网、移动应用开发、人工智能、大数据分析等。他们可以参与开发网站、移动应用程序、游戏、人工智能算法等。他们还可以在金融、电子商务、医疗保健等各行各业中应用他们的编程技能。

    4. 创新和问题解决能力:编程控制专业培养学生具备创新思维和问题解决能力。学生会接触到各种实际问题和挑战,需要运用他们的编程知识和技术来解决这些问题。他们需要具备逻辑思维、系统分析和设计的能力,以及解决复杂问题的能力。

    5. 就业前景和发展机会:编程控制专业的毕业生在当今信息化社会中有广阔的就业前景和发展机会。随着技术的不断进步和创新,计算机软件领域的需求也在不断增长。编程控制专业的毕业生可以选择在软件开发公司、科技企业、互联网公司、金融机构、医疗保健机构等行业工作。此外,他们还可以选择成为自由职业者,从事独立软件开发或咨询服务。在技术领域的进一步发展和学习,他们还可以选择攻读研究生学位以深化专业知识和技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程控制是计算机科学与技术领域中的一个专业方向,主要涉及计算机编程和控制技术的研究与应用。编程控制专业培养学生掌握计算机编程的理论和技术,以及掌握现代控制理论和方法,能够运用计算机技术和控制技术解决工程问题。下面,我将从课程设置、操作流程等方面详细介绍编程控制专业。

    一、课程设置

    编程控制专业的课程设置包括计算机基础、编程技术、控制理论等多个方面。主要课程包括:

    1.计算机基础:包括计算机组成原理、数据结构与算法、操作系统、数据库原理等课程,培养学生对计算机硬件和软件的基本理解和应用能力。

    2.编程技术:包括C语言、Java、Python等编程语言的学习和应用,培养学生熟练掌握一门或多门编程语言,能够进行程序设计和开发。

    3.控制理论:包括模拟控制系统、数字控制系统、自动控制原理等课程,培养学生对控制系统的理论和方法的掌握,能够进行控制系统的设计和调试。

    4.电子技术:包括电路原理、模拟电子技术、数字电子技术等课程,培养学生对电子技术的理解和应用能力,为电子控制系统的设计提供支持。

    5.工程实践:包括实验课程和实践项目,培养学生动手能力和解决实际问题的能力,加强对理论知识的实践应用。

    二、操作流程

    1.学习编程技术:学生通过学习C语言、Java、Python等编程语言,掌握编程的基本理论和技术,包括语法、算法、数据结构等。

    2.学习控制理论:学生通过学习控制理论和方法,了解控制系统的基本原理和方法,包括PID控制、状态反馈控制等。

    3.实践项目:学生通过实践项目,运用所学知识和技术,完成一些具体的工程项目,如机器人控制系统、自动化生产线等。

    4.实验课程:学生通过实验课程,进行实际的控制系统的调试和测试,熟悉仪器设备的使用和数据采集、处理等技术。

    5.毕业设计:学生在毕业设计中,选择一个具体的控制系统项目进行设计和实现,如智能家居系统、无人驾驶汽车等。

    三、就业方向

    编程控制专业毕业生可以在工控系统、自动化设备、电子设备、信息技术等领域就业。常见的职业岗位包括:

    1.软件工程师:负责软件开发、测试和维护工作,设计和实现控制系统的软件部分。

    2.控制工程师:负责控制系统的设计、调试和维护工作,熟悉控制理论和各种控制方法。

    3.自动化工程师:负责自动化设备的设计、安装和调试工作,熟悉自动化技术和系统。

    4.电子工程师:负责电子设备的设计、制造和维护工作,熟悉电子技术和电路设计。

    5.软件测试工程师:负责软件测试和质量保证工作,保证控制系统的稳定性和可靠性。

    总之,编程控制专业培养学生在计算机编程和控制技术方面的专业能力,为他们未来在相关领域的就业提供了良好的基础。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部